在WPF中创建动态CRUD UI

3
我正在尝试制作一个简单应用程序,以测试我们编写的一些CRUD代码。我希望数据输入UI从被输入的对象动态构建。
例如,如果它是一个ICustomer对象,它具有名称属性,IOrders集合和一些其他属性。这些接口的定义存在于一个单独的dll中。
请问您有什么好的方法来实现这个?我想到可以使用反射动态创建UI(通过代码而不是XAML)。这是一种好的做法吗?
1个回答

0

您可以使用 CodePlex 上的 WPF DataForm,该控件与 The Silverlight Toolkit 中的 DataForm 表现相似。

当您将一个对象绑定到该控件时,它会自动生成一个数据输入表单。


谢谢decyclone,但是我的对象还有其他自定义对象和集合作为属性。DataForm能够处理吗? - ganeshran
为什么不试一试呢?我只用它来处理简单的类。 - decyclone

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接